The Maine State Lottery announced that Wednesday’s Powerball jackpot is an estimated annuitized $300 million. No one has won the jackpot since Nov. 4.
The Maine State Lottery says overall odds of winning are approximately 1 in 24.9.
If a jackpot winner wants to take the winnings in one lump sum instead of yearly, the value is estimated at $184 million.
